Overview
Edit the score metadata
Defined Under Namespace
Classes: EnumAttributeValidator
Instance Attribute Summary collapse
-
#arranger ⇒ Object
The arranger of the score.
-
#composer ⇒ Object
The composer of the score.
-
#creation_type ⇒ Object
Returns the value of attribute creation_type.
-
#description ⇒ Object
Description of the creation.
-
#license ⇒ Object
Returns the value of attribute license.
-
#license_text ⇒ Object
The rights info written on the score.
-
#lyricist ⇒ Object
The lyricist of the score.
-
#privacy ⇒ Object
Returns the value of attribute privacy.
-
#sharing_key ⇒ Object
When using the
privacymodeprivateLink, this property can be used to set a custom sharing key, otherwise a new key will be generated. -
#subtitle ⇒ Object
The subtitle of the score.
-
#tags ⇒ Object
Tags describing the score.
-
#title ⇒ Object
The title of the score.

#list_invalid_properties ⇒ Object
Show invalid properties with the reasons. Usually used together with valid?
205 206 207 208 209 210 211 212 213 214 215 216 217 218 |
# File 'lib/flat_api/models/score_modification.rb', line 205 def list_invalid_properties warn '[DEPRECATED] the `list_invalid_properties` method is obsolete' invalid_properties = Array.new pattern = Regexp.new(/^[a-f0-9]{128}$/) if !@sharing_key.nil? && @sharing_key !~ pattern invalid_properties.push("invalid value for \"sharing_key\", must conform to the pattern #{pattern}.") end if !@description.nil? && @description.to_s.length > 2000 inv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"description",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 2000.') end invalid_properties end |
